Calculating Your Energy Usage Check your electricity bill for your average monthly kWh usage. Multiply your average monthly usage by 12 to get your annual usage. Factor in any anticipated changes in energy consumption.
Adequate sunlight exposure: South-facing roofs are optimal, but east- and west-facing roofs can also be effective. Minimal shading: Ensure that there are no obstructions like trees or buildings that could cast shadows on your panels. Sufficient space: The amount of roof space available will determine the number of panels you can install.
Roof Condition and Material Ensure your roof is in good condition and can support the weight of the panels. Certain roofing materials like asphalt shingles, metal, and tiles are more suitable for solar panel installation.
Grid-tied systems: These are connected to the local power grid and allow you to use solar power while still drawing electricity from the grid when needed. Off-grid systems: These are not connected to the grid and typically require battery storage to provide power during cloudy days or at night. Hybrid systems: These combine both grid-tied and off-grid features, offering more flexibility and reliability.
Benefits and Considerations Grid-tied: Lower upfront cost, potential for net metering. Off-grid: Independence from the grid, but higher cost due to batteries. Hybrid: Best of both worlds, but more complex and expensive.
Efficiency: Higher efficiency panels produce more electricity in a given amount of space. Durability: Look for panels with a strong warranty and a proven track record of durability. Cost: Balance the initial cost with the long-term savings and benefits.
Types of Solar Panels Monocrystalline: High efficiency and space-efficient but more expensive. Polycrystalline: Less efficient but more affordable. Thin-film: Flexible and lightweight, but lower efficiency.
Types of Inverters String inverters: Most common and cost-effective but less efficient if shading occurs. Microinverters: More efficient and perform well with shading but more expensive. Power optimizers: Combine features of string inverters and microinverters, offering a balanced solution.
Battery Storage Options Lithium-ion batteries: High efficiency and longer lifespan but more expensive. Lead-acid batteries: More affordable but lower efficiency and shorter lifespan.
Certifications and experience: Ensure they are certified by relevant authorities and have ample experience. Positive reviews and references: Check online reviews and ask for references from past clients. Comprehensive warranties: A good installer should offer strong warranties on both the installation and the equipment.
Questions to Ask Potential Installers How many installations have you completed? Can you provide references from previous clients? What kind of warranties do you offer on your work and the equipment?
